Abstract

The invention discloses an alarm method and an alarm thereof, wherein the method comprises the following steps: the alarm acquires surrounding environment information through a sensor, wherein the environment information comprises obstacle information and position information; the alarm judges whether an obstacle exists according to the obstacle information, if so, judges whether the obstacle is a vehicle or a pedestrian, if so, judges whether the area can perform sound alarm according to the position information, if so, judges whether the current time can perform sound alarm, and if so, executes sound alarm. Through the analysis of the surrounding environment information, the limitation requirement of the surrounding environment on the alarm is automatically judged to realize automatic alarm, and the technical problem that the alarm in the prior art cannot automatically realize the alarm according to the limitation requirement of the specific surrounding environment on the alarm is solved.

Background
At present, the alarm working state control in the prior art is manual control and can be divided into three types, namely, the closing state and the opening state of the alarm and the triggering state. And in the closed state, the alarm is in a closed state all the time, and the alarm cannot be realized. The alarm is in an always-on state in the on state, the alarm is in a whistling or alarm lamp flashing state all the time, and the trigger state means that the alarm is triggered, for example, the alarm is executed after being touched.
In an application scenario, however, a control limitation on noise pollution often occurs, and a whistle alarm is prohibited in some specific areas (such as some core areas) or in a specific period (such as a college entrance examination period). On the other hand, in some special cases, whistling must be implemented. Especially special vehicles such as fire engines, police vehicles, etc. Therefore, an alarm technical scheme is urgently needed to automatically alarm according to the surrounding environment. The applicant has found that it is not possible to whistle, i.e. sound, with an alarm at certain times (such as nights or high-examination hours) or in certain locations (areas with a relatively high flow of people) of many scenes according to relevant regulations. The alarm in special equipment (such as a fire truck and an ambulance) has two alarm modes of sound alarm and alarm light prompt alarm, and the alarm in the prior art has three working states, namely a closed state, an open state and a trigger state, wherein the closed state means that the alarm is closed, and neither sound alarm nor alarm light alarm is performed. The on state is that sound and warning light alarm are simultaneously executed. The triggering state can be executed only by manually touching a triggering part on the alarm, but no matter the working state of the alarm, the alarm cannot be flexibly executed according to different specific places or specific time.
FIG. 1 is a flow chart of the alarm method of the present invention. As shown in fig. 1, in one embodiment, the present application provides an alarm method, comprising:
s101, the alarm can acquire surrounding environment information through a sensor, wherein the environment information comprises obstacle information and position information;
in this step, a specific embodiment is provided in which the alarm obtains the environmental information and the location information through the sensor. It should be noted that the position information may be obtained by the sensor or may be calculated by a processor provided in the alarm. For example, it is known that the alarm is mounted on the special vehicle, and the initial departure point of the special vehicle can obtain the position of the special vehicle, that is, the position information, through the traveling path of the special vehicle. Still alternatively, the position information may be determined by acquiring surrounding landmarks or the like by the sensor.
S201, the alarm judges whether an obstacle exists according to the obstacle information, if so, judges whether the obstacle is a vehicle or a pedestrian, if so, judges whether the area can be subjected to sound alarm according to the prestored alarm-capable area plan according to the position information, if so, judges whether the current time can be subjected to sound alarm according to the prestored alarm-capable time plan of the area, and if so, executes the sound alarm.
In this step, a specific embodiment of making the alarm according to the obstacle information and the position information is provided. In this step, the alarm determines whether the obstacle exists according to the obstacle information, and if the obstacle exists, the alarm determines whether the obstacle is the vehicle or the pedestrian according to whether the obstacle can move. Only when the barrier is the vehicle or the pedestrian, can only take effect when the alarm reports to the police, because only drive the people of vehicle or the pedestrian can only by the alarm is influenced, notices the alarm avoids or dodges. It should be noted that the identification of the vehicle or the pedestrian can be realized by means of image identification, which can be easily performed by those skilled in the art, and therefore, the details are not repeated herein. And if the barrier is a vehicle or a pedestrian, judging whether the area can be subjected to sound alarm according to the position information and a prestored alarm area plan, wherein the judgment basis can be the alarm area plan which is already stored in the alarm, and the prestored alarm area plan can be acquired from a cloud end or a server in a communication mode. If the area can be used for sound alarm, whether sound alarm can be carried out at the current time according to the pre-stored alarm time planning of the area is judged through a preset timer, then the alarm can obtain the current time through the built-in timer, it needs to be pointed out that the current time can be obtained through a network, then whether sound alarm can be carried out is judged according to the sound alarm time planning, and the alarm time planning can adopt the same obtaining mode as the area planning. And if the current time can be subjected to sound alarm, executing sound alarm. At this time, whether the vehicle or the pedestrian exists or not is judged whether the vehicle or the pedestrian exists in the region and time where the alarm can be given, and whether the alarm is given or not is executed according to the surrounding environment information.
In addition, it should be noted that the alarm-enabled area planning and the alarm-enabled time planning should be planning for alarm in advance for areas and time, and there is a sequence between the areas and the time planning, and the areas should be determined first, and then the time is determined.

In an embodiment, the at least one sensor 1 comprises a distance sensing sensor 11 and/or an infrared night vision sensor 12 and/or a video image sensor 13.
In the embodiment, a specific implementation manner of the sensor is provided, if the alarm is installed on the special vehicle and at least one sensor 1 comprises three distance sensors 11, the three distance sensors 11 can be installed and are respectively located at the left front part, the middle part and the right front part of the special vehicle, and the distance sensors 11 are used for measuring the distance between the obstacle in the preset range and the special vehicle. The processor 21 may obtain a current speed of the special vehicle, and then determine whether the front object is in a moving state according to the distance measured by the distance sensor 11, and if the front object is in the moving state, the front object is the vehicle or the pedestrian at a high probability. The method for determining the front target according to the distance and the current speed of the special vehicle is a method known by those skilled in the art, and will not be described herein again. The two sides of the special vehicle can also be respectively provided with four distance sensors 11 to measure the obstacle information on the two sides of the driving lane, the measuring range can be adjusted to be more than 3 meters so as to meet the requirement of the actual road width, and if the distance between the obstacles on the two sides of the special vehicle is kept unchanged, the obstacles on the two sides, such as guardrails, are probably arranged on the two sides. In addition, if the distance between the special vehicle and the pedestrian or the vehicle in front is over when the distance is less than the predetermined threshold, it is necessary to cause the alarm to perform an alarm.
In addition to the distance sensor 11, in order to prevent false alarm and simultaneously collect the obstacle information through the video image sensor 13, six video image sensors 13 may be installed on the special vehicle, wherein two video image sensors 13 are located on the left side of the top right in front of the special vehicle and on the right side of the top right in front of the vehicle. The lens of the video image sensor 13 positioned at the left side of the top right of the front is deviated to the right by a first predetermined angle, and the lens of the video image sensor 13 positioned at the right side of the top right of the front is deviated to the left by a second predetermined angle, so that the lenses can collectively cover the area right in front of the special vehicle. In addition, the four video image sensors 13 are respectively installed at the head and the tail of the special vehicle at two sides and are located at the top of the special vehicle, and the video images should be inclined to the ground by a certain angle. Pictures or videos of the video images taken at a certain frequency are sent to the processor 21 as the environment information. In order to improve the condition of obtaining the environmental information under the conditions of poor lighting conditions, namely night and dark weather, six infrared night vision sensors 12 are arranged in front of and around the special vehicle. The infrared night vision sensor 12 collects information by reflecting infrared rays actively emitted therefrom, and is used for assisting in collecting the environmental information in environments with poor lighting conditions such as night, dark weather, and the like. The infrared night vision sensor 12 is grouped, mounted, data-transmitted and processed in substantially the same manner as the above video image sensor 13.
In one embodiment, the alarm body is provided with a 5G communication module 3 and a positioning signal receiver 4.
In this embodiment, a specific embodiment is provided in which the communication and location means are located locally to the alarm. The positioning signal receiver 4 is installed at a proper position on the top of the special vehicle, calculates the position information and the current time by continuously receiving signals of positioning satellites, and sends the position information and the current time to the processor.
The 5G communication module 3 is installed at a proper position on the top of the special vehicle and is electrically connected with the processor through a data bus. The receiving and transmitting antennas in the 5G communication module 3 are connected with a 5G base station in a cellular network and are used for transmitting the environmental information collected by the video sensor and the infrared night vision sensor on the special vehicle.
